"Kidnapped Toddler Rescued, Suspect Shot Dead in Hamilton County Police Chase"

TL;DR Summary
Two Hamilton County Sheriff's deputies were shot during a pursuit involving a kidnapped 18-month-old child and an armed suspect, who was later identified as 33-year-old Tyler Lebron Roberts and died on the scene. The deputies successfully used a spike strip to stop the suspect's vehicle near the I-75 Ooltewah exit, leading to an exchange of gunfire. The kidnapped child was unharmed and taken to a local hospital for evaluation, while the deputies are expected to recover. The Tennessee Bureau of Investigation is investigating the incident.
